Step 1: Prepare Baking Pan
Grab a 9-inch round baking pan and generously coat it with butter or cooking spray.
Dust the pan with flour, tapping out any excess to create a non-stick surface for your cake.
Step 2: Mix Dry Cake Ingredients

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ugar
Using an electric mixer, blend softened butter and sugar in a large bowl.
Beat until the mixture becomes light, fluffy, and pale yellow, creating a smooth base for your cake.
Step 4: Add Wet Ingredients
Incorporate vanilla extract into the butter mixture.
Add e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ition to create a smooth, cohesive batter.
Step 5: Combine Cake Batter
Gently fold the dry ingredients and sour cream into the wet mixture.
Alternate between adding flour mixture and sour cream, mixing until just combined.
Avoid overmixing to keep the cake tender.
Step 6: Arrange Peaches
Pour the batter into the prepared pan, spreading it evenly.
Arrange fresh peach slices in a single, beautiful layer across the top of the batter.
Step 7: Create Crumb Topping

Step 8: Add Crumb Topping
Sprinkle the crumb mixture generously and evenly over the peach-topped batter, ensuring complete coverage.
Step 9: Bake the Cake
Place the pan in a preheated oven at 350°F.
Bake for 45-55 minutes until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ean and the top turns a gorgeous golden brown.
Step 10: Cool and Serve
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ool completely in the pan on a wire rack.
Slice and serve as is, or top with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for extra indulgence.

You can use Greek yogurt or buttermilk as direct replacements for sour cream. Both options will provide similar moisture and tanginess to the cake.
Choose peaches that are slightly soft when gently pressed and have a sweet, fragrant aroma. Avoid peaches that are rock hard or have bruises and dark spots.
Yes, you can use frozen peaches. Just thaw and drain them completely before adding to the cake to prevent excess moisture. Pat the peaches dry with paper towels to remove extra liquid.
Make sure your crumb topping is cold and clumpy before sprinkling. Also, do not overmix the cake batter and ensure the peaches are placed in a single layer to help keep the topping on top during baking.

Southern Peach Crumb Cake Recipe
- Total Time: 1 hour 20 minutes
- Yield: 8 1x
Description
Sweet southern peach crumb cake brings comfort straight from Georgia’s orchards, blending ripe fruit with buttery streusel. Warm spices and tender crumb promise a delightful dessert slice you’ll savor with pure Southern charm.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ients:
- 4 fresh peaches, sliced (or 1 15-ounce / 425 grams can of sliced peaches, drained)
- 2 eggs
- 1 cup (240 milliliters) sour cream
- 1 stick / 1/2 cup (113 grams) butter, softened
Dry Ingredients:
- 1 1/2 cups (180 grams) all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up (100 grams) s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Flavor Enhancers:
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
Instructions
- Prepare the oven environment by heating to 350°F and preparing a 9-inch round baking pan with butter and flour coating to ensure easy cake removal.
- Create the cake base by sifting fl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t together in a medium mixing bowl.
- In a separate large bowl, whip sugar and butter until achieving a light, airy texture with a smooth consistency.
- Introduce vanilla extract and eggs into the butter mixture, incorporating them gently and thoroughly to maintain a smooth batter.
- Carefully f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ture, alternating with sour cream, mixing just until ingredients are combined without overmixing.
- Transfer the cake batter into the prepared pan, spreading it evenly to create a uniform base.
- Artfully arrange fresh peach slices across the batter’s surface in a single, decorative layer.
- Construct the crumb topping by blending brown sugar, flour, cinnamon, and salt in a separate bowl.
- Integrate melted butter into the dry mixture, stirring until the ingredients form delicate, craggy clusters.
- Generously distribute the crumb topping over the peach-adorned batter, ensuring complete and even coverage.
- Slide the pan into the preheated oven and bake for 45-55 minutes, monitoring until a toothpick emerges clean and the surface turns a rich golden hue.
- Remove from the oven and allow the cake to rest and cool completely on a wire rack before cutting.
- Serve the cake as a standalone dessert or enhance with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
Notes
- Always use ripe, juicy peaches for the most vibrant flavor and natural sweetness in your crumb cake.
- Room temperature ingredients like eggs and butter blend more smoothly, creating a more tender cake texture.
- For a gluten-free version, swap regular flour with a cup-for-cup gluten-free baking blend to accommodate dietary restrictions.
- Enhance the peach flavor by adding a splash of almond extract or sprinkling some ground nutmeg into the crumb topping for extra warmth.
